About Emanuele

Emanuele, a boy’s name of Italian origin, embodies the profound belief in divine presence, carrying the beautiful meaning of "God is with us". Derived from the Hebrew name Emmanuel, Emanuele has been embraced by Italian-speaking communities for centuries, offering a heartfelt expression of faith and hope.
